Overview

Postcode WR11 7RT is located in a rural village, within the Broadway, Sedgeberrow & Childswickham ward of Wychavon in the West Midlands region, and forms part of the Broadway, Wickhamford & Sedgeberrow area. It has low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 27.1 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 72% below the West Midlands average of 97 per 1,000. The average income per household in Broadway, Wickhamford & Sedgeberrow is £51,857 per year. The nearest station is Evesham, about 2.9 miles away.

Frequently asked questions about WR11 7RT

Is WR11 7RT (Broadway, Wickhamford & Sedgeberrow) safe?

The area around WR11 7RT records about 27 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a very low crime rate for England: it scores 2 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level. Across West Midlands as a whole the rate is about 97 per 1,000. The most common offences locally are violence and sexual offences, anti-social behaviour and criminal damage and arson.

What is the average house price near WR11 7RT?

The median sale price around WR11 7RT in Broadway, Wickhamford & Sedgeberrow is £500,000 (about £419 per square foot) based on 72 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.

How deprived is the area around WR11 7RT?

WR11 7RT scores 4 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. Its neighbourhood ranks 21,887 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).

Who represents WR11 7RT (Broadway, Wickhamford & Sedgeberrow) in Parliament and on the local council?

The Member of Parliament for Droitwich and Evesham covering WR11 7RT is Nigel Huddleston (Conservative and Unionist Party), elected at the 2024 general election. The area is represented by 2 local councillors: Emma Augusta Sophia Sims (Conservative and Unionist Party) and Emma Jane Kearsey (Conservative and Unionist Party).
